I am following the Cloudify user guide – its pretty easy to follow, and have installed a local deployment successfully.

Now I want to add users and passwords to the web management interface, how to do this? By default, the web interface supports anonymous login.

    Assuming your aim is to obtain full control over deployments, use the Cloudify shell (or “Cloudify CLI”).

    As the Cloudify shell currently exposes read-only operations, it does not require login details. Configuring secured access for the REST API, however, can be done using spring security (which will be documented soon).
